Newbie here. I'm loading up my iPad 2 16 gig way too fast with new songs created on Auria and need to send them to my PC hard drive. How do I do this so I can reload them later into the iPad to remix or edit? Thanks!

I recommend getting a free program called iFunBox. It lets you look inside your iPad's disk and copy files back and forth. Auria projects are folders, and so it's just a matter of copying the project folder to your computer, then back again when you want to use it.

I've got WiFi drive support on my list for a future update, and this will probably support a few of the available devices, but it's not practical to add support for everything. Unfortunately there's no standard for these things, and Apple doesn't provide any standardization for external WiFi drives.
